About RBR: Making waves since 1973

At RBR, we’ve been designing cutting-edge instruments to measure our blue planet for over 50 years. Built to withstand some of the harshest environments on Earth, our instruments are deployed from the ocean’s deepest trenches to the polar ice caps, capturing essential data on water temperature, salinity, pH, and more. This data empowers researchers in the global fight against climate change, and our technology supports groundbreaking science with partners like Fisheries and Oceans Canada, Woods Hole, the Scripps Institution, and the British Antarctic Survey.

What you’ll do

You’ll be a key contributor to Ruskin, our flagship Java-based software that plays a central role both inside and outside RBR. It’s used by researchers worldwide to deploy our instruments and visualize ocean data, and by our in-house calibration team to ensure each of our instruments meets rigorous accuracy standards.
